We currently have a vacancy for a Security Coordinator, working for an aerospace and defence client based in Rochester. The Security Coordinator will support the Site Security Office and wider Security Function. Working closely with the Security Assistant, you will oversee and assist the Security Manager with the day-to-day running of the Security Office, helping implement all security requirements. You will achieve this by providing administrative support and guidance on all aspects of protective security, vetting and security policy.

Due to the nature of our client's business, the successful candidate will be customer focused, preferably with experience gained in a similar role/environment.

Core duties:
  • Main Security Liaison between the Security Office and Reception
  • New start security liaison (Taleo, recruitment team, Security Watchdog)
  • Leaver security liaison (ensure return of classified equipment/documents, site badge and car pass, etc.)
  • Monitoring help desk calls placed by the team/guards to ensure they are completed
  • Monitoring of daily Car Park checks/vehicle infringements
  • Sateon: adding of employees to access control doors, issuing of security badges, new starts, contractors, forgotten/lost/damaged/non-functioning badges
  • Sateon: running system reports for investigations
  • Processing Sateon photo release request forms and emailing of photos in line with GDPR
  • Issuing of long stay parking permits to staff leaving vehicles on site whilst away on business
  • Security Office walk ins, assisting with customers/employees
  • Updating of clearance records, classified material, contracts and IVCO requests
  • Approval of Team Centre/Winchill requests
  • Processing of IVCO inwards/outwards visits
  • Maintaining and processing of the site Visitor database
  • Receipt and despatch of classified material via the DCS, or other approved courier
  • Destruction of classified material
  • Musters and spot check lead
  • Processing of clearances
  • Liaising with outside agencies to collate Contractors paperwork and clearances
  • Processing of laptop requests for T3F4
  • Vetting Lead for ES UK business (including AIRs, CoPC)
  • Processing of access requests for T3F4
  • Assist on Security investigations
  • Collate and administer new starter paperwork (OSA, Confidentiality Agreements, staff pass, vehicle pass)
  • OH liaison on security related matters
  • Air Cargo Clearance liaison
  • Liaison with Securitas guarding team
  • Area Access audits
  • On site company camera audits
  • FSC company checks
  • Security processing of IT account requests for new starters
  • Conduct Security briefings when required
  • CCTV operator, to allow assistance during investigations
  • Establishing and enforcing office policies
  • Maintaining a clean and organised office
  • Providing support for Security initiatives
  • Improving communication in the office
  • Administration of the access control system, including issuing security passes
  • Liaising with Line Managers to ensure equipment, documents, passes and other company assets are returned, as and when required
  • Processing visitors and contractors via the Visitor system
  • Advising on vetting: both in-house and NSV. In-house vetting checks to be completed to Cabinet Office BPSS standards
  • Receipt, despatch and destruction of sensitive material, including spot checks and musters
